U.S. Polo Assn. Complaint Regarding Warranty-Covered Product

Dear Sir/Madam, I purchased a navy blue suitcase (Product Code: PIVLZ221269) from the USPA store on 26.02.2022. At the time of purchase, I was informed that a 5-year warranty covered the product. However, following my recent trip to Paris, the suitcase arrived with two broken wheels and a detached handle. While I was informed at the airport that I could receive a replacement suitcase, I relied on the warranty and chose to have the suitcase sent for repair through the USPA branch at Sayapark Mall. On 17.01.2025, I got a written response from your company saying that the damages are not covered under warranty because they are deemed to be caused by user error. However, I would like to emphasize that a warranty guarantees the product against defects in manufacturing or durability for the specified period. Issues such as broken wheels and a detached handle indicate the product is no longer functional and should not be attributed solely to user misuse. I would like to ask that this product be repaired or replaced under the terms of the warranty. I look forward to hearing back from you promptly. Otherwise, I will have no choice but to escalate this matter by filing a complaint with the Consumer Arbitration Committee.

On 21/01/2015, a call was made by USPA. First, they said they wanted to get information about my grievance, and I repeated the same things. The lady on the phone asked from whom I 'learned' that the warranty period was 5 years. Although the current warranty period for suitcases is two years, when I purchased the suitcase in 2022, the warranty period was 5 years. In short, I was told that a review would be conducted with the units about whether there would be another inspection, and I would be contacted back. I am waiting.
